After a little investigation, it seems a bit suspicious. Ad mentions a steel chassis but the Rossa is a fibreglass monocoque, according to what I've found (I had forgotten all I'd ever known about the car). It's supposed to be 1982, but production didn't start till 1987, although it might be registered as a rebodied Mini which might explain that.
